What Are Antioxidant Plant Extracts?
Antioxidant plant-based extracts are concentrated forms of bioactive compounds that reduce oxidative stress in the body. These compounds are found naturally in plants and are essential for maintaining cellular health, slowing aging, and preventing inflammation and chronic disease. Extracting them in concentrated forms allows for easier formulation and broader use across various industries, from pharmaceuticals and nutraceuticals to skincare, food, and beverages.
Standard classes of antioxidants and their botanical sources include:
Polyphenols – Found abundantly in green tea, berries, and dark chocolate; known for their anti-inflammatory and cardioprotective properties.
- Flavonoids – Present in citrus fruits, onions, and cocoa; these act as potent free radical scavengers and immune boosters.
- Terpenes – Volatile aromatic compounds found in herbs such as rosemary, thyme, and basil, offering both antioxidant and antimicrobial effects.
- Cannabinoids – Bioactive compounds in hemp and cannabis, such as CBD and CBG, which demonstrate antioxidant, neuroprotective, and anti-inflammatory activity.

Why Extraction Matters: Preserving Antioxidant Integrity
Plant extracts’ antioxidant potency can be compromised during production. Conventional extraction methods such as ethanol, CO₂ supercritical, and hydrocarbon-based systems often rely on high temperatures, prolonged extraction times, and aggressive chemical solvents. While these techniques may effectively separate compounds from the plant matrix, they also tend to damage sensitive molecules.
Antioxidants, particularly polyphenols and terpenes, are notoriously fragile. When exposed to heat or oxygen, they degrade quickly, losing their beneficial effects and compromising the overall quality of the extract. Additionally, post-extraction processes such as winterization, filtration, and solvent evaporation can further diminish the extract’s integrity and increase production costs.
This is why choosing the proper extraction method is not just a technical decision – it’s a product-quality imperative.
